<title>Exploring Mt Tapyas </title>
<description>
Its a must ! !  When you get to CORON it is must to visit this stunning Mountain.. The trek was made easy for tourist, they made a concrete stairs all the way to the top or the view deck... From their you will see the  town of Coron and its beautiful landscape.

Just a precaution.. better take streching before banging the hike little bit of cardio.. kundi lawit dila nyo at mangingnig tohud nyo heheheh...

The other side of the peak is wonderfully shaped hill with its very relaxing grass. A haven for photogs.. its like your in Africa&#x27;s wild place that usually seen on National Geographic...</description>

<title>Banol Beach at Coron Palawan</title>
<description>Banol Beach and its surrounding waters is one of the many ancestral domain of the Indigenous TAGBANUA people. 

It is a small part of the island but surprisingly it has a spectacular clear water, powered white sand and beautifully formed limestones.</description>
